What is the Level 5 Extended Diploma in Business and Enterprise?
The Level 5 Extended Diploma in Business and Enterprise is an advanced qualification aimed at individuals seeking to develop a deep understanding of business principles, management strategies, and entrepreneurial skills. It is equivalent to the second year of a bachelor’s degree and is recognized globally by employers and educational institutions.
Key Features of the Course:
- Focus on practical business skills and real-world applications.
- Comprehensive coverage of topics such as marketing, finance, operations, and leadership.
- Opportunities to develop entrepreneurial thinking and innovation.
- Flexible learning options, including online and part-time study.

Course Structure and Modules
The Level 5 Extended Diploma in Business and Enterprise typically covers the following modules:
Module
Description
Business Environment
Explores the external factors influencing business operations and decision-making.
Marketing Principles
Focuses on developing effective marketing strategies and understanding consumer behavior.
